- [ ] Step 7: Archive cold storage buckets (Glacierline tier). Confirm both ceremony witnesses are present, verify bucket manifests match the Oxbow ledger, then seal the archive key shares. Plugin authors may observe but not handle shares. Once sealed, the archive index itself is encrypted and can only be reopened with the passphrase below.

vault phrase of badup-hahig = tamael-aldael-kelmir-istael-fenok-istwyn-tamius-jorath-oliion

## Runbook: Websocket Reconnect Storm (Pylonix Gateway)

If plugin clients reconnect in tight loops after a gateway restart, the jittered backoff is likely disabled. Verify your plugin honors the retry-after frame before escalating to the Pylonix team. Check the gateway's reconnect settings against the reference configuration below.

config for kafof-bawef:
holath:
  log_level: debug
  metrics_host: metrics.holath.qorvelsys.internal
  pin: 2191
  pool_size: 32

Ticket: Configuration drift detected on Farecourt rules engine

During the quarterly review we found that the production Farecourt instance, which computes shipping fees for the Dellhaven storefront, no longer matches the values committed in the infra repo. Three rule thresholds and one rounding mode were changed manually in October, apparently during an incident, and never backported. This means audited fee logic differs from what reviewers approved. For reference, the live instance currently reports the following configuration.

deployment values, kajep-kageg:
[praix]
host = praix.paliqcorp.corp
user = praix_svc
database = praix_prod

### Checklist: Spreadsheet Export Memory

Before you sign off on the Tallybird release, run the big-sheet export test (the 400k-row fixture) and watch heap usage — last time it ballooned past 2 GB because rows weren't streamed. If it stays under the cap, tick this box and paste the build token from the export job right here below.

pipeline stamp: htk9_ce63042d9